After recently announcing his withdrawal from Nandi Kiss Racing asdriver, Sydney’s Nandi Kiss has surprisingly agreed to return to the wheel forthe second round of the Dunlop Series at Barbagallo Raceway late next month.

“We’ve come to a mutual agreement with Chris Alajajian to release fromhis arrangement with NKR effective from today,” explains Kiss, “there are nohard feelings but Chris has made the decision not to continue beyond his firstround with us at The Clipsal 500.”

Alajajian had a challenging return to competition in Adelaide after atwo-year hiatus but Kiss was pleased with the improvement the young Sydneysiderhad made over the course of the weekend.

“Personally I’d love Chris to have gone on to Barbagallo and feel his way intothe car again,” says Nandi, “he was definitely coming to grips with the car andthe way our team works. I think he would have been right where he and we neededhim by the end of Round Two.”

So for now, Kiss will return to the driving duties unless a replacement driveris found.

Advertisement

“It’s definitely my plan to get back in the seat if we don’t find areplacement driver by Perth,” Nandi explains, “The show must go on. At thisstage we haven’t spoken to any drivers about taking the wheel so for the momentI’m re-shuffling my business commitments so that I can give the driving theattention it requires. These cars take a strong commitment to fitness and yourmental approach needs to be spot on. I’ve always enjoyed driving these cars,but I think my longer-term future in the category is as a car owner. We’ll seeI guess.”

Kiss believes there are a couple of key points that will work in hisfavour. 

 “At least I’ve done all the tracks on this year’s calendar so Ihave a benchmark to work beyond and with the Kelly Holden engine we put in thecar this year that has 40 more horsepower than our old engine program I’mlooking forward to better personal results than last year.”
